3875 - Programmer: What is the maximum programming frequency achieved with HW-USBN-2A cable, while programming MachXO2 device using Slave Serial Programming Interface (SSPI)?
The maximum achievable Slave Serial Programming Interface (SSPI) programming frequency with HW-USBN-2A cable is 1.5 MHz, when the TCK value is either set to 0 or 1.
For other values of TCK (2 to 10), the SSPI programming frequencies are listed below:
TCK | Frequency
0 1.5 MHz
1 1.5 MHz
2 125 kHz
3 93.75 kHz
4 75 kHz
5 62.5 kHz
6 53.58 kHz
7 46.88 kHz
8 41.67 kHz
9 37.5 kHz
10 34 kHz
Related Articles
7740 - How to enable SSPI programming in MachX03-9400 Development Board
Setup to enable SSPI in MachX03-9400 development board. Connect to JP2, MCLK, SI, SO, SS, 5V SPI, GND to USBN programming cable. Connect FTDI, do a JTAG chain scan, make sure JTAG can program. Connect USB programming cable. Set to Slave SPI ...
5248 - Crosslink: How to program the CrossLink through I2C with Lattice Diamond Programmer and Lattice HW-USBN-2B download cable or MCU-based I2C programming using I2CEMBEDDED?
The CrossLink device is programmable using SPI or I2C. Thus, the programming is supported through: 1. SPI/I2C-based embedded programming (SSPIEMBEDDED or I2CEMBEDDED) using an Embedded MCU, or 2. SPI/I2C operations through Lattice Diamond Programmer ...
6936 - Diamond/Radiant Programmer: HW USBN programmer not scanning the device and I2C function does not work.
Problem: Case 1: I cannot use the I2C function of my HW-USBN-2B Case 2: Model300 programmer does not recognize HW-USBN-2B Case3: When doing JTAG scan with HW-USBN-2B, I am detecting the following devices. MachXO2 and ispPAC Power Manager II. See ...
6212 - Programmer: Is HW-USBN-2B compatible with the MACH4A5 (M4A5) family?
The MACH4A5 is a 5V core device and cannot be programmed with an HW-USBN-2B cable. The HW-USBN-2B supports the programming of Lattice devices with a core voltage of up to 3.3V. Programming devices with a 5V core requires the HW-USBN-2A USB cable or ...
7090 - HW-USBN-2B: Why Lattice USB Programming cable is not working and the LED light is always on?
Description: There is a known issue where cable firmware with version "V001" may cause the USB programming cable to malfunction with LEDs light always on in certain scenario. Solution: The workaround is to update the cable firmware and FTDI firmware ...